Jinsong Han is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Biomedical Engineering and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Jinsong Han has authored 81 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Molecular Biology, 26 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 19 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Jinsong Han's work include Advanced Chemical Sensor Technologies (22 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(18 papers) and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(12 papers). Jinsong Han is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Chemical Sensor Technologies (22 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(18 papers) and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(12 papers). Jinsong Han collaborates with scholars based in China, Germany and United States. Jinsong Han's co-authors include Uwe H. F. Bunz, Kai Seehafer, Markus Bender, Benhua Wang, Linxian Li, Fei Li, Huishan Wang, Róbert Langer, Lei Miao and Kaitlyn Sadtler and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and ACS Nano.
